Went there, still in a state after the earthquakes not a great deal to because everywheres still on the rebuild. The shipping container shopping centre was cool. 

Country as a whole is good easy to settle there as everyone speaks the same language and they drive on the same side of the road, really easy to travel about all cities (we would call them towns I lived in Gisborne and that was a city of 30k people!) have airports and airnz are good for cheap flights. People are friendly and like people from the UK. living costs are quite high tho food is expensive.

Worst of all beer is expensive and they don't do pints
